Claims
- 1. A holding element for holding a fastener for securing the fastener to a carrier plate comprising:a holding plate having a hole that is adapted to receive said fastener, an intermediate portion extending from said holding plate substantially parallel to an axis of said hole and an end portion extending from said intermediate portion substantially parallel to said holding plate; a mounting element extending from said holding plate in a direction away from said carrier plate, said mounting element adapted to hold a construction element; and said mounting element comprising a pair of spaced clamping elements for holding the construction element therebetween.
- 2. The holding element of claim 1, wherein said mounting element is integrally formed on said holding plate.
- 3. The holding element of claim 1, wherein said end portion further comprises a holding tab that extends from said end portion.
- 4. The holding element of claim 3, said holding tab is parallel to a wall of a head of said fastener.
- 5. The holding element of claim 4, said holding tab has a length that terminates at a height above said holding plate that is smaller than a height of said head of said fastener.
